66.9.131.70 - robtex.com

Riyadh, Riyadh Region, πŸ‡ΈπŸ‡¦ Saudi Arabia Β· AS209342 NIC-SDAIA-Deem

Search for stuff

66.9.131.70 checked at 2026-01-18T15:38:48.992Z 0ms 10/10/10 100% R:0 allDone:true timedOut:false cfaller:89cc3dfb/5:eb509e58:6:19456:-:-:-